Find your
perfect stay

Parkwood Hotel

Picture London, that grand old dame of cities, its bustling streets lined with stories as thick as the fog that used to wrap its rooftops. Now, tuck yourself away in a snug little corner just a stone‚Äôs throw from the hubbub of Marble Arch, and you’ve found The Parkwood Hotel a beacon of comfort and charm that…

Pexels Vecislavas Popa
The Savoy-budget

The Landmark Hotel London, with its Victorian grandeur and contemporary comforts, is an oasis amidst the excitement of this global city. As I, Paul Theroux, explore every nook and cranny of this extraordinary hotel, I can’t help but be captivated by the allure of its storied past and…